采用基团贡献法估算了1, 5-二叠氮基-3-硝基-3-氮杂戊烷(DIANP)的溶解度参数。用浊度滴定法测定了其溶解度参数。研究了DIANP在不同溶剂中的溶解性。结果表明, 基团贡献法的估算值与浊度滴定法的测定值相吻合。测得DIANP的溶解度参数为22.29 (J/mL) 1/2。DIANP在不同溶剂中的溶解性符合“溶解度参数相近相溶”原则。
